Personally I'd like to see less motions in stunts. Some teams spend an eight count just doing motions, when they could be doing more innovative stunts! Obviously sometimes the motions really do add to the stunt, but other times they just make the stunt seem very simple, but trying to be flashy.

I always think this same thing! There was an 8 count a worlds team had that involved motions 1234 and mess their hair around 5678. All while standing with a dead leg. Really?!
 
I really wish there was creative movement in stunts. I know (or at least am pretty sure) it's part of the score sheet, but I'm tired of seeing 5 flyers just standing there in extensions while the groups move to satisfy the scores.

More double-sided stunting, meaning I'd like to see good technique on the opposite side when doing tic-tocs.

It would be really nice for teams to stretch both sides, so we can have more innovative versions of tic-tocs than just doing a bent-leg heel-stretch. Like right-sided scorpions, scales, bow-and-arrows.

Definitely agree with this. I would like to not be able to tell if they're flying on their "bad" leg due to the all around terrible heel stretches. Waiting for a team to get scorps on both legs. the CREATIVITY.
 
AKA, arabesques that would have my ballet teacher screaming "YOU LOOK LIKE A DOG AT A FIRE HYDRANT!". It'd also be nice to see them without the chest dropped and the leg barely above a 90 degree angle. It's possible for the leg to go higher than that and not drop one's chest...
